I will research them but you should know if they aren't licensed/legal an ACH block is only a temporary fix, illegal lenders change their names and debit huge amounts from your account, they also sell or share your information with other Internet illegal lenders.
You shouldn't send out any letters to these lenders until your account is closed, if you do they will go in and wipe out your account.

All of these lenders are illegal/unlicensed, nor are any of them CSO's. I would advise you to close your account, all of these lenders are known to have numerous alias's which they will use to debit your account. Banks can only do so much, they require a list of names and will only block the names on that list, if one of these lenders uses one of their alias' to take money from your account the bank can not stop them, this is why it's important that you close the account. Your account will never be safe again, it is now in the hands of criminals.
